Output 39e8f43b4af2684346450d29f90646ddef27d90c4e1598c0e349f7032a68d27c:383

value
13390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 572e75ffbb985236644385060054f0ce7fe2e157 OP_EQUALVERIFY OP_CHECKSIG
address
18wySrPRjnHY4EVCz5GX2vNfbgkkQhrv9V
transaction
39e8f43b4af2684346450d29f90646ddef27d90c4e1598c0e349f7032a68d27c
spent
true